Concert of the acclaimed composer Panagiotis Karousos for Europe Day 2024


 Hellenic Literary Society

Thursday, May 9, 2024 at 7:00 p.m.
8 Gennadiou and Akadimias (7th floor), 106 78 Athens
-Greetings: Kostas Karousos, President of Hellenic Literary Society
Celebration concert for Europe Day, 9 May 2024,
with works by Internationally Renowned Composer Panagiotis Karousos
The "Rhapsodes" Choir and soloists of the music composer Panagiotis Karousos are participating: Rea Voudouri, Irini Konsta, Petros Salatas, Nina Giatra, Giannos Kotzias, Yannis Darreios, Argyris Kotonikolaou, Maria Kioroglou, Konstantinos Papalexis. Christiana Manou (piano). Coordination: Rea Voudouri (soprano). Artistic Direction: Panagiotis Karousos (composer)
Program - Poetry set to music by composer Panagiotis Karousos:
Parthenon (Costis Palamas), Caryatids (John Polemis), Spring Symphony (Yiannis Ritsos), Daughter of Athens (Lord Byron), Oh Nature (Kostas Karousos), In an Old Temple (Miltiadis Malakasis), The Enchanted Fountain (Kostas Krystallis), Silence (Kostis Palamas), Choral "Achilles Shield" and Helen's aria from the opera "Homer's Iliad"
On Europe Day every year on 9 May we celebrate peace and unity in Europe. This date marks the anniversary of the historic 'Schuman Declaration', with which Robert Schuman set out his proposal for a new form of political cooperation in Europe, capable of making war between European nations unthinkable. Robert Schuman's proposal is considered the beginning of today's European Union.
The Hellenic Literary Society was founded on May 19, 1934 with headquarters in Athens and professional writers as members. Its purpose and position is "the production of intellectual and cultural work while at the same time fighting for the rights of the Greek writers of the place as a whole".
Panagiotis Karousos is a composer of the Renaissance type whose music focuses on man. He became known through his operas (Prometheus Bound, Trachinies – Olympic Flame, Alexander the Great, Iliad), while recently he made an opening in popular songs in lyrics of great Greek and foreign poets. Many media have mentioned his work, while he has been awarded repeatedly in Greece and abroad, for his contribution to art.
